JOB OVERVIEW:


As a Material Handler, you will play a crucial role in the efficient operation of the hospital by handling, organizing, and managing inventory.

Your

responsibilities may include receiving, storing, and distributing materials, products, and equipment within the department and throughout the hospital

we service. This role demands attention to detail, physical stamina, and the ability to work in a fast-paced environment.


D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ES:
Under the direction of the Logistics Manager and Supervisor, the Material Handler is responsible for some or all of the duties below and other duties as


assigned:

Receiving and Unloading:

  • Receive incoming shipments and verify the accuracy of the items and their quantities.
  • Unload and inspect deliveries for damages and discrepancies.
  • Record and report any discrepancies or damages to the supervisor.
  • Staging of nonstock and capital products for delivery
  • Advise Manager and/or Supervisor of short supply
  • Maintaining and assisting with accurate records of all outgoing and incoming shipments and related courier paperwork
  • Coordinate with purchasing team to resolve PO discrepancies and issues.

Coordination of Inventory:

  • Organize and store materials in designated locations within the
department.

  • Maintain backup inventory.
  • Maintain accurate records of inventory levels and locations using
inventory management systems.

  • Conduct periodic physical inventory counts to ensure accuracy.
  • Ensure inventory on supply carts is current including PAR levels

Order Picking and Packing:

  • Pick items from designated locations according to pick lists or orders.
  • Pack and prepare items for shipment, ensuring proper packaging to prevent damages.
  • Label and tag products accurately.

Shipping and Dispatch:

  • Prepare shipping documents and labels for outgoing shipments.
  • Ensure trucks are loaded with the correct items in a safe and efficient manner.
  • Coordinate with shipping carriers and couriers to ensure the accuracy and timely delivery of parcels.

Quality Control:

  • Inspect products for defects or damages before shipping.
  • Report any quality issues to the supervisor.
  • Ensure that all products meet quality standards.
  • React swiftly in the event of a recall to isolate affected product(s) and coordinate shipments to vendor(s).
  • Attention to detail ensure accuracy and delivery of correct supplies.

Department Maintenance:

  • Keep the department clean and organized.
  • Perform regular maintenance tasks which can include disposing of debris.
  • Ensure that aisles and walkways are clear and safe for movement.

Safety Compliance:

  • Adhere to safety guidelines and protocols.
  • Use appropriate personal protective equipment (PPE) as required.
  • Report any safety hazards or incidents to the supervisor immediately.

Collaboration:

  • Work closely with other team members to achieve daily operational goals in a fastpaced environment.
  • Communicate effectively with supervisors, colleagues, and other departments.
  • Liaise with internal stakeholders to help drive efficient processes and continuous improvement throughout the hospital sites.

Equipment Operation:

  • Operate warehouse equipment such as electric pallet jacks, hand trucks and scanners.
  • Ensure equipment is properly maintained and report any malfunctions.
